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SCMTMS/TCM_FO_COMM -
Message number: 041
Message text: External ID is not maintained for role and function

/SCMTMS/TCM_FO_COMM041
indicates that there is an issue with the configuration of the Transportation Management System (TMS) in SAP, specifically related to the external ID not being maintained for a particular role and function. This error typically arises in the context of integration scenarios where external systems or services are involved.Cause:
The error is caused by the absence of an external ID that is required for a specific role and function in the TMS configuration. This can happen due to:
- Incomplete Configuration: The necessary external ID has not been set up in the system for the relevant role or function.
- Missing Master Data: The master data related to the transportation management roles may not be fully maintained.
- Integration Issues: If you are integrating with external systems, the required mappings or identifiers may not be correctly defined.
Solution:
To resolve this error, you can follow these steps:
Check Role and Function Configuration:
- Navigate to the TMS configuration settings in SAP.
- Verify that the role and function associated with the error message are correctly configured.
- Ensure that the external ID is maintained for the relevant role and function.
Maintain External ID:
- Go to the relevant customizing transaction (e.g., SPRO) and find the section for TMS configuration.
- Look for the option to maintain external IDs for roles and functions.
- Enter the required external ID for the role and function that is causing the error.
Review Master Data:
- Ensure that all necessary master data related to transportation management is correctly maintained.
- Check if any relevant entries are missing or incorrectly configured.
Integration Settings:
- If the error is related to integration with external systems, review the integration settings.
- Ensure that all necessary mappings and identifiers are correctly defined and maintained.
Testing:
- After making the necessary changes, test the functionality to ensure that the error no longer occurs.
